1970 Volkswagen Convertible Title: Clear Texas Title Mileage: Approx. 42,000, subject to change as I drive it on a daily basis. Note: Mileage is exempt on this vehicle. Body: Color is an electric blue shade, with some minor dents and dings. There are several rust spots ranging from the size of a quarter to the size of a dollar in the usual locations for these cars. This is an older restoration that is still current to stock specifications. The entire floor pan was replaced recently, the frame and undercarraige are good and solid. New convertible top.. Convertible tops are a major expense for these cars. Still has the original AM radio, however it doesn't work. May just need to be connected, not sure. I'm not much of a radio person. All the glass is in great shape, including the rear glass window. Tires are in great shape. Interior: The interior is in great shape, all restored to factory specs. Black vinyl seats and door panels, black carpet. All window cranks work well, dash and steering wheel are in good shape. Instrument cluster is good. Note: speedometer recently stopped working after I had the brakes done, the needle is stuck at 50mph. All other gauges work as they should. The car will pass inspection, i.e. the horn, wipers, signal lights are all in good working order. Mechanical: I believe this to be the original 1600cc 4 cylinder engine. I have religiously maintained this car, oil changed every 3,000 miles and all running gear lubed. She fires up the first time every time. I drive this car 60 miles to work 3 times a week with no problems, very dependable. Clutch is good, 4-speed manual transmission shifts smoothly. Misc: Also included in sale is a convertible boot, orignal spare tire and jack, and other misc parts. Overall, this is a great running and collectible car. This can be a garage queen or daily driver ( I prefer to drive my toys). This car isn't perfect, but she looks and runs great for a 44yr old piece of German history and enginuity.
